Craft artists, fine artists, painters, sculptors and illustrators, as well as multi-media artists and graphic designers make up the art industry. All artists usually follow their natural talent with a degree or other training program, which gives them credibility when looking for work with a prospective employer or through self-employment. For either method, there are more available talented artists than there is demand for their work, so positions and clientele are highly coveted. Most artists begin working part-time to build their portfolio while still in school or while working at other jobs until they have enough regular work to constitute being a full-time artist.
